ROUND HILL, TOWN OF is one of 107 community water systems in Virginia in the 3,301 to 10,000 people size category, serving 5,055 people from groundwater.
As of August 1, 2026, its federal record holds 13 entries between 1993 and 2012, all of which EPA lists as closed. Nothing has been added since 2012.
Of the 13, 7 are monitoring and reporting requirements — the category that accounts for about four in five of all violations in EPA's national dataset — rather than findings about the water itself. The record involves the Total Coliform Rules and the Radionuclides and Revised Rad Rule.

What is a Consumer Confidence Report?
- A Consumer Confidence Report (CCR) is the annual drinking water quality report that community water systems must provide to the people they serve. It lists the contaminants detected in the system’s water during the year, where the water comes from, and how the results compare with federal limits. EPA’s revised CCR rule takes effect January 1, 2027, and the first reports in the new format are due July 1, 2027.
